U+11D8B "ð‘¶‹" Gunjala Gondi Vowel Sign I is a combining diacritical mark used in the Gunjala Gondi script to represent the vowel sound "i". This script is an alphasyllabary primarily employed for writing the Gondi language, which is spoken by the Gondi people in central India, particularly in the state of Telangana. The vowel sign attaches to a consonant character to modify its inherent vowel, creating a distinct syllable with the short "i" sound. Its inclusion in the Unicode Standard helps preserve and digitally encode this endangered script, supporting linguistic heritage and modern electronic communication for Gondi speakers.

General Properties

Code Point U+11D8B
Version Added 11.0
Name Gunjala Gondi Vowel Sign I
Block Gunjala Gondi
General Category Spacing Mark
Canonical Combining Class Not Reordered
Bidirectional Class Left To Right
